Fedders Holding Ltd (FEDDERSHOL) last traded at ₹40.8, a market capitalisation of ₹822 crore, on a P/E of 10.8. Over the past 52 weeks the stock has ranged between ₹28.6 and ₹63.5. Fedders Holding Ltd last reported results for the quarter ended Jun 2026, with sales of ₹69 crore and net profit of ₹11 crore. Figures are as of 25 Aug 2026 and are not real time.

Fedders Holding Ltd quarterly results

In the quarter ended Jun 2026, sales were ₹69 cr, down 10.4% from ₹77 cr a year earlier. Net profit was ₹11 cr, down 31.3% year on year.

Fedders Holding Ltd shareholding pattern

Promoters held 65.84% at Jun 2026, broadly unchanged since Jun 2025. FIIs 0.20% and DIIs 0.17%.
